Risk Summary
Louisiana's statewide risk profile is dominated by flood exposure, hurricanes, low elevation, and heat.
South Louisiana carries the sharpest flood and hurricane burden, but inland metros still face severe heavy-rain exposure.
Insurance Market
Louisiana's insurance market is heavily stressed, especially in flood-prone and hurricane-exposed parishes.
- Flood insurance can be central to affordability, not a side policy.
- Storm losses and rebuilding costs have increased underwriting pressure statewide.
